Understanding Reckless Driving and Its Legal Implications in San JoseReckless driving, under California law, is more than just a traffic infraction. It is a criminal offense defined by an intentional disregard for the safety of persons or property. This can manifest in many forms, from excessive speeding through crowded areas near downtown San Jose to weaving dangerously through lanes on Highway 87 or Capitol Expressway, or even driving under the influence of substances. When a driver operates their vehicle with such a conscious and wanton disregard for the probable injurious consequences, they are acting recklessly. Unlike simple negligence, which may involve carelessness, reckless conduct demonstrates a deliberate indifference to the risks involved. This distinction is crucial in personal injury claims because it can impact the types and amounts of damages an injured party might recover. Recovering Comprehensive Damages After a San Jose Reckless Driving AccidentVictims of crashes caused by an unsafe motorist often face significant economic and non economic damages. Economic damages are quantifiable losses, such as past and future medical expenses, including hospital stays at places like Santa Clara Valley Medical Center, rehabilitation, therapy, prescription medications, lost wages, diminished earning capacity, and property damage to your vehicle. These are directly calculable financial setbacks. Non economic damages address the intangible losses you experience. This includes physical pain and suffering, emotional distress, mental anguish, loss of enjoyment of life, and disfigurement. In cases involving extreme recklessness, California law may even allow for punitive damages. Punitive damages are not meant to compensate the victim but rather to punish the at fault driver for their egregious conduct and deter similar behavior in the future. How is reckless driving legally defined in California?In California, reckless driving is defined as operating a vehicle with a willful or wanton disregard for the safety of persons or property. This means the driver intentionally drove in a dangerous manner, knowing the risks involved, rather than simply being careless or negligent. Examples include excessive speed, street racing, or weaving dangerously through traffic. Can I still recover compensation if I was partially at fault for the accident?California operates under a pure comparative negligence system. This means you can still recover damages even if you were partially at fault for the accident. However, your compensation will be reduced by your percentage of fault. For example, if you are found 20 percent at fault, your damages will be reduced by 20 percent. How long do I have to file a lawsuit after a reckless driving accident in California?In California, the general statute of limitations for personal injury claims is two years from the date of the accident. For claims involving property damage only, the limit is three years. There are very limited exceptions, so it is critical to consult with a personal injury attorney as soon as possible to avoid missing these deadlines.
